Revision d31115e0
Added by Niels Hoffmann over 13 years ago
taxeditor-editor/src/main/java/eu/etaxonomy/taxeditor/section/classification/ClassificationDetailElement.java | ||
---|---|---|
13 | 13 |
import org.apache.log4j.Logger; |
14 | 14 |
import org.eclipse.swt.SWT; |
15 | 15 |
|
16 |
import eu.etaxonomy.cdm.model.common.IAnnotatableEntity; |
|
17 | 16 |
import eu.etaxonomy.cdm.model.common.LanguageString; |
18 |
import eu.etaxonomy.cdm.model.taxon.TaxonomicTree;
|
|
17 |
import eu.etaxonomy.cdm.model.taxon.Classification;
|
|
19 | 18 |
import eu.etaxonomy.taxeditor.forms.CdmFormFactory; |
20 | 19 |
import eu.etaxonomy.taxeditor.forms.CdmFormFactory.SelectionType; |
21 | 20 |
import eu.etaxonomy.taxeditor.forms.ICdmFormElement; |
... | ... | |
31 | 30 |
* @created Sep 27, 2010 |
32 | 31 |
* @version 1.0 |
33 | 32 |
*/ |
34 |
public class ClassificationDetailElement extends AbstractCdmDetailElement<TaxonomicTree> {
|
|
33 |
public class ClassificationDetailElement extends AbstractCdmDetailElement<Classification> {
|
|
35 | 34 |
|
36 | 35 |
|
37 | 36 |
private static final Logger logger = Logger |
... | ... | |
60 | 59 |
/** {@inheritDoc} */ |
61 | 60 |
@Override |
62 | 61 |
protected void createControls(ICdmFormElement formElement, |
63 |
TaxonomicTree entity, int style) {
|
|
62 |
Classification entity, int style) {
|
|
64 | 63 |
text_treeLabel = formFactory.createTextWithLabelElement(formElement, "Label", entity != null ? entity.getTitleCache() : null, SWT.NULL); |
65 | 64 |
selection_reference = (ReferenceSelectionElement) formFactory.createSelectionElement(SelectionType.REFERENCE, getConversationHolder(), formElement, "Reference", entity != null ? entity.getReference() : null, SWT.NULL); |
66 | 65 |
text_microReference = formFactory.createTextWithLabelElement(formElement, "Reference Detail", entity != null ? entity.getMicroReference() : null, SWT.NULL); |
Also available in: Unified diff
added a readme file